dwarf2out.c (mem_loc_descriptor): Use DW_OP_mod for UMOD instead of MOD...
* dwarf2out.c (mem_loc_descriptor): Use DW_OP_mod for UMOD instead of MOD, handle MOD using DW_OP_{over,over,div,mul,minus}. (loc_list_from_tree): Don't handle unsigned division. Handle signed modulo using DW_OP_{over,over,div,mul,minus}. * unwind-dw2.c (execute_stack_op): Handle DW_OP_mod using unsigned modulo instead of signed. * gcc.dg/cleanup-13.c: Expect DW_OP_mod to do unsigned modulo instead of signed, add a few new tests.
